摘 要:目的探讨外阴阴道念珠菌病(vulvovaginal candidiasis,VVC)患者血清及阴道分泌物中超氧化物歧化酶(superoxide dismutase,SOD)、谷胱甘肽过氧化物酶(glutathione peroxidase,GSH-Px)、氧化末端产物晚期糖基化终末产物(advanced glycation end products,AGEs)、晚期氧化蛋白产物(advanced oxidation protein products,AOPP)的表达水平及临床意义。方法选本院就诊的51例轻中度、21例重度VVC及33例复发性外阴阴道念珠菌病(recurrent vulvovaginal candidiasis,RVVC)患者为观察组,39例正常体检者为对照组,采用ELISA检测SOD、GSH-Px、AGE、AOPP水平,分析各指标及其与VVC临床症状间的相关性。结果血清中,重度VVC及RVVC组AGEs水平低于对照组(P均<0.05),轻中度VVC及重度VVC组AOPP水平均低于对照组(P均﹤0.05),重度VVC组SOD及GSH-Px水平高于对照组(P均﹤0.05);分泌物中,重度VVC组AGEs、AOPP水平显著低于对照组(P均﹤0.05),轻中度VVC、重度VVC组、RVVC组SOD水平均高于对照组(P均﹤0.05),重度VVC组、RVVC组GSH-Px水平均高于对照组(P均﹤0.05)。相关性分析发现:分泌物中AGEs、AOPP与SOD、GSH-Px表达均呈负相关(r=-0.25,-0.45;P均﹤0.05);血清中GSH-Px与疾病严重程度呈正相关(r=0.21,P﹤0.05),分泌物中SOD与疾病严重程度呈正相关(r=0.22,P﹤0.05)。结论VVC患者体内存在AGE、AOPP水平下调及SOD、GSH-Px水平上调,氧化应激相关因子SOD、GSH-Px水平与VVC的疾病严重程度有关,SOD、GSH-Px、AGE、AOPP可能参与VVC的发病。Objective To investigate the expression and clinical significance of superoxide dismutase(SOD),glutathione peroxidase(GSH-Px),advanced glycation end products(AGEs),advanced oxidation protein products(AOPP)in serum and excretion of patients with vulvovaginal candidiasis(VVC).Methods This study included 51 patients with mild-to-moderate VVC,21 with severe VVC,and 33 with recurrent vulvovaginal candidiasis(RVVC)as the observation group,and 39 healthy people who underwent physical examination as the controls.ELISA was used to detect the expression of SOD,GSH-Px,AGE and AOPP,and the association of the expression of these indexes with the clinical symptoms of VVC was analyzed.Results In serum,the levels of AGEs in severe VVC group and RVVC group were lower than those in control group(both P<0.05).The levels of AOPP in mild-to-moderate VVC and severe VVC groups were higher than those in control group(both P<0.05),and the levels of SOD and GSH-Px in severe VVC group were higher than those in the control group(both P<0.05).In the secretion,the levels AGEs and AOPP in the severe VVC group were significantly lower than those in control group(both P<0.05).The levels of SOD in mild-to-moderate VVC,severe VVC and RVVC groups were significantly higher than those in control group(all P<0.05).And GSH-Px in the severe VVC and RVVC groups were significantly higher than those in control group(both P<0.05).Correlation analysis found that in secretion,AGEs and AOPP in secretion were negatively correlated with SOD and GSH-Px expression(r=-0.25,-0.45;P<0.05).GSH-Px in serum was positively correlated with the severity of the disease(r=0.21,P<0.05),and SOD in secretion was positively correlated with disease severity(r=0.22,P<0.05).Conclusion The down-regulation of AGE,AOPP and upregulation of SOD and GSH-Px were detected in patients with VVC.The oxidative stress-related factor SOD and GSH-Px were correlated with the severity of the disease.These laboratory indicators may be involved in the pathogenesis of VVC.
